If the axle on your hub is a 'normal' axle, ie: it is a threaded rod that goes through the hub, and
a nut clamps down on it from each side, then you should be able to.

however, there are all kinds of axles. your axle has a diameter (like 10mm, or 9.5, etc), and a
thread spec (26 threads per inch, etc). to use all the hardware like the spacers and cones inside
your hub, you need to get a matching axle.

what changes is

a) your new axle for quick release will be hollow
b) the length gets shorter, because the axle needs to sit inside the dropouts, so that the quick
release clamps on the dropout face, not the axle. waht length the axle needs to be depends on
what spacing your bike is. i think the modern standard is 130 for road, 135 for mtb, and it
changes for old, tandem, and otherwise eccentric breeds.

I realize now that my post is confusing- The rear dropout spacing is not the same as the length of
axle you need. Ie: If you have a modern road bike with 130 mm spacing between the dropouts, you do
not need a 130 mm axle. You need slightly longer so that there is some axle sticking out into each
dropout, but not enough that it is flush with the outside of the dropout face. For instance, if your
dropouts are 5 mm thick, and your hub spacing is 130mm, then an axle length of 136 mm would probably
be fine. I imagine that axles are already pre-cut to appropriate lengths for various spacings, so
any guesswork will be eliminated.

Sure you can. I just did it for my wife's old Fuji. I had to buy a hollow axle with bearing cones,
locknuts and spacers (came in a kit) plus a Quick Release lever. It all came to about $30 at my
LBS. Take your wheel to the bike store to be sure of getting the right parts. If, first, you remove
your old axle by removing the LEFT side lock nut and cone, you might save a few dollars of
disassembly charge.

If it is for a rear wheel, you will need to pull the freewheel (I assume your bike is older and has
one of these.) If you do not have a puller, your LBS can do it for you.

Doing the job consists of making the spacers be the same length as the spacers on your old axle.
Then, from the right side, first screw on the cone, then slide on the spacers then screw on and
tighten (very tight) the lock nut so that 5 mm of axle sticks out to the right, beyond the lock nut
face. Re-assemble the axle and bearings in the hub, and adjust the left cone and lock nut so that
there is no side to side play in the axle. Measure 5 mm out beyond the lock nut face on the left and
mark it. Remove the axle and cut it with a hack saw or, better yet, a Dremmel cut off tool. De-burr
the cut end, remove the cutting debris, clean, grease and re-install everything and you're almost
done. The last thing to do is to install the new QR lever, mount the wheel on the bike and look at
the length of the rod. If it sticks out beyond the QR nut, cut off the excess. Now, you are done

You can avoid all the above work by buying a new wheel. A cheapo wheel will cost around $60 at your
LBS...less via mail order.

To the OP: unless I am missing something, or you have an odd setup, you should not feel compelled
to buy a kit, nor a new wheel. Although these options can save time, the only new piece you Really
need is a hollow axle that matches your current hardware. I believe these run around 12 dollars or
less. If you don't have a skewer lying around (or don't live in an area where there are hundreds of
rusted dead wheels locked to fences where the rest of the bike has been stolen) then that would run
you a few more.
